The story of James William J. W. Carroll began in 1917 in Tennessee. In 1920, James William J. W. Carroll resided in Civil District 4, Henry, Tennessee. In 1930, James William J. W. Carroll resided in District 9, Henry, Tennessee. James William J. W. Carroll passed away in 2009 in Dresden, Weakley, Tennessee.
